Key Buying Factors for Filbert Brush Set for Artists

Bristle Material

Synthetic bristles are versatile, easier to clean, and often the best all-around choice for acrylic, gouache, and watercolor. Hog bristle is stiffer and holds its shape well, which makes it a better fit for oil paint and textured applications. Softer filbert brushes can be useful when you want less visible stroke marks.

Size Range and Shape Consistency

Look for a set that includes both smaller and mid-size filberts if you need detail plus broader blending. Consistent shape matters just as much as size count; a well-formed filbert should have a balanced oval tip and spring back cleanly after use.

Handle Length

Long handles are generally better for easel painting and oil work, while shorter handles can feel more controlled for desk-based work, illustration, and close-up detail. Choose based on your usual painting posture and surface size.

Use Case

The best Filbert Brush Set for Artists depends on medium and technique. Acrylic painters often benefit from synthetic sets with multiple sizes. Oil painters may prefer stiffer hog bristles. Watercolor and gouache users usually want softer brushes that release paint more smoothly.

Who Should Buy Which Filbert Brush Set for Artists?

Beginners should usually start with a synthetic set that covers several common sizes and works across multiple mediums. Acrylic and mixed-media artists should prioritize durability and easy cleanup. Oil painters should lean toward hog bristle or other firm brushes for better paint control. Watercolor artists may prefer softer filberts for smoother washes and blending. If you paint across several media, a larger mixed set can be the most efficient choice.

In short, focus on bristle type, size variety, and handle comfort before counting pieces. That combination will help you choose a set that feels natural, performs well, and stays useful as your skills grow.
